Bribery Attempt
Chiefs of Quresh: “If you want money, we can give you enough to make you the richest
man amongst us. If you want to become a leader, we will make you our king. If you want
to have a pretty wife, we can find you the most beautiful in all Arabia.”
The Prophet: “O Quresh, I do not want any of these things. I am a Prophet of God. I have
been sent to you with a message. If you hear me, it will be to your good. If you do not I
will patiently wait on the Lord.”
The Quresh then asked him to change the dry sands of Mecca into green gardens.
The Prophet: “I am only a Prophet and servant of God. But if you obey God, you will
have the best of this world and of the life to come.”
To the north of Makkah at a distance of approximately 250
miles there is a city called Madinah.
Idolators of Madinah
Background

• Jewish people possessed superiority over Idolaters of Madinah in terms of


knowledge and religion, and were generally ahead in wealth and power as well,
and therefore, commanded a special influence over them.
• If an Idolater did not have any male children, he would vow that if a male child is
born to me, I shall make my first baby boy a Jew.
• Through Jews, the Idolater tribes of Madinah became somewhat aware of the divine
scriptures and prophetic dispensation. The Jews would say to them that a prophet is
soon to be commissioned. Upon his advent, by supporting him, we shall annihilate
the infidels and idolaters. He shall establish a powerful sovereignty, and by
following him, we shall become powerful, so on and so forth.
Consultation of about 100 men of the Quraish including a ‘Satan’ in
the person of an aged man named Najdī Sheikh
Dialogue:
An individual: Tie Muḥammad with iron chains and lock him up in a room that he may
stay there until death overtakes him.
Sheikh Najdī: This idea is not appropriate, because when Muḥammad’s relatives and
followers find out about this, they will surely attack and free him. Then this dispute will
progress even further.
Another individual: Exile Muḥammad. For if he is far from sight and leaves our city,
then what do we care as to where he goes and what he does? At least our city will find
deliverance from this disorder.
Sheikh Najdī: Have you not witnessed the sweet tongue, eloquent and enchanting
speech of Muḥammad? If he leaves unharmed, then know well that some other tribe of
Arabia will be lured into his deceit and will sweep forth against you and there shall be
nothing you can do about it.
These mutual discussions continued until Abū Jahl bin Hishām said:
Abū Jahl: My opinion is that one young man should be selected from every
tribe of the Quraish each, and they should be given swords. Then these people
should attack Muḥammad together as one man, and murder him. In this
manner, his blood shall be distributed throughout all the tribes of the Quraish,
and the Banū ‘Abdi Manāf will not have the courage to fight all the people.
They will have no choice but to accept his blood-money. As such, we shall pay
that.
Sheikh Najdī: If there is a proposal, it is of this man, for all else is rubbish. If
you wish to do something, then do as this man proposes.
God informed Holy Prophet (sa) through Gabriel (as) of Quraish’s evil
intentions. He was instructed not to spend the following night in Makkah.
Hadrat Abū Bakr (ra) had nourished two camels by feeding them the leaves of
an acacia tree in preparation of migration.
In the darkness of the night, the cruel Quraish from various tribes had besieged
the home of the Holy Prophet (sa) with their bloodthirsty intentions.
Holy Prophet (sa) invoked the name of Allāh, and left his home. At that time,
the besiegers were present in front of the Holy Prophet’s door. However, they
were in such a state of unawareness that the Holy Prophet left right through
their midst, leaving them in their ignorance, and they had not a clue.
The entire matter had been pre-settled with Hadrat Abū Bakr (ra), to meet en-
route, and reach Cave of Thaur. The cave is situated South of Makkah at a
distance of about three miles atop a wild and abandoned mountain, at a
substantial height. Its trail is also very difficult to cross.

On Thursday, April 26th, 1984,
the Chief Martial Law Administrator and the President of Pakistan,
General Zia-ul-Haq introduced
‘The Anti-Islamic Activities of the Quadiani Group, Lahori Group and
Ahmadis (Prohibition and and Punishment) Ordinance, 1984’
thereby criminalizing the life of Ahmadis in Pakistan.
One motive was to cripple the Jama’at of Promised Messiah by
putting the Khalifa in Jail perpetually.
Six seats were booked on KLM flight from Karachi leaving very early
in the morning on Monday, April 30th.

Rabwah and all its entry/exit points were under the surveillance of
five different security agencies of General Zia.

Huzoor insisted that there should be no lies or duplicity about his


departure. He would not be disguised nor use a false passport.
Shortly after Fajr prayers, Huzoor’s regular car left Rabwah with
Huzoor’s brother dressed in achkan and turban sitting in the back seat.
The car had its normal escort with Huzoor’s personal security sitting
inside. It was presumed that Huzoor was on the way to Islamabad,
some 200 miles away.
At 2 a.m., two other cars had left Rabwah. They took a minor road
and finally got on to the main highway to Karachi, which was 750
miles away. In the first car were Huzoor’s security staff. In the second
car was the Huzoor.
Only those who had absolute need to know knew. Most members of
Huzoor’s family did not know to prevent any accidental slip out.
Shortly after the decision of how and when he would leave - which
was in two days’ time - a letter was delivered from Usman Chou
(Chinni) sahib. Chinni sahib had had a dream that he did not
understand, but which he believed contained some kind of message
for Huzoor. In his dream he had seen that the Khalifa’s car was about
to leave for Islamabad. He had approached in order to pay his
respects, but when he looked in the side window he saw that the car
was empty.“I was shocked and cried out…Then a voice told me that
the Khalifa had left by another route and that he had gone abroad….”
